A new visitor center

A new Visitor Center at the Palais des Nations to discover the United Nations family in Geneva.

The Fondation Portail des Nations is currently building a new Visitor Center for the United Nations in Geneva. This new UN Geneva Visitor Center, located at the entrance of the Palais des Nations (along the Alley of Flags), will open its doors to the public on 20 March 2026.

In addition to the guided tours of Palais des Nations, the Visitor Center, open 7 days a week, from 9 am to 6 pm, will offer an immersive experience dedicated to the multilateral role and the work of the United Nations in Geneva. Box office opens on January 13, 2026.

Origin

The Portail des Nations project is an initiative led by Ivan Pictet. He responded to the call made by the United Nations Secretary-General, António Guterres, during his swearing-in before the UN General Assembly on 12 December 2016.

“I am convinced that we must anticipate the growing demand for information from a broad audience eager to better understand global challenges and the issues that arise from them, as well as to become more familiar with the responses provided by multilateralism embodied by the United Nations and other international organizations based in Geneva.”

IVAN PICTET
President of the Fondation Portail des Nations

“We need to communicate more effectively about what we do so that everyone can understand. We need to fundamentally reform our communication strategy by modernising the tools and channels through which we engage with the world.”


ANTÓNIO GUTERRES

United Nations Secretary General

Behind the scenes

The project to build a set of five pavilions, representing a total area of nearly 2,000 m², was born out of the need for UN Geneva to have an entrance and facilities dedicated to welcoming visitors to the Palais des Nations.
